首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

电脑连接不到mysql数据库服务器

电脑连接不到MySQL数据库服务器可能是由于以下几个原因导致的:

  1. 网络连接问题:首先,确保你的电脑与MySQL数据库服务器在同一个局域网内,并且网络连接正常。可以尝试使用ping命令检查网络连通性,例如在命令行中输入ping <数据库服务器IP地址>,如果能够收到回复表示网络连接正常。
  2. 防火墙设置:防火墙可能会阻止电脑与数据库服务器之间的连接。确保防火墙允许从你的电脑访问数据库服务器的端口(默认为3306)。如果你使用的是Windows操作系统,可以在控制面板中找到Windows Defender防火墙进行相应设置;如果是Linux操作系统,可以使用iptables或firewalld命令进行设置。
  3. MySQL服务器配置问题:检查MySQL服务器的配置文件(通常是my.cnf或my.ini),确保MySQL服务器监听的IP地址和端口与你的电脑上的连接设置一致。默认情况下,MySQL服务器监听所有IP地址,但也可能配置为仅监听特定IP地址。
  4. 用户权限问题:确保你使用的MySQL用户具有足够的权限来连接数据库服务器。可以尝试使用root用户进行连接,或者创建一个具有适当权限的新用户。
  5. MySQL服务是否正在运行:检查MySQL服务是否正在运行。在Windows操作系统中,可以在服务管理器中查找MySQL服务并确保其状态为“正在运行”。在Linux操作系统中,可以使用systemctl或service命令来检查和启动MySQL服务。

如果以上步骤都没有解决问题,可以尝试以下额外的调试步骤:

  1. 检查MySQL服务器的日志文件,通常位于MySQL安装目录的data文件夹下。查看错误日志文件(通常是以.err为后缀的文件),以获取更多关于连接问题的详细信息。
  2. 尝试使用命令行工具(如MySQL命令行客户端或telnet命令)连接到MySQL服务器,以确定是否是特定于应用程序的问题。

如果问题仍然存在,建议咨询相关的技术支持团队或寻求专业的数据库管理员的帮助。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券